EW has posted a new (well, a close-up version of the previous group shot) image of Oscar Isaac as the titular villain of X-Men: Apocalypse, and it gives us a much better idea of how he'll appear in the film. Isaac also reveals why they went with the look they did...

So yeah, fans are not too impressed with what they've seen from Bryan Singer's big-screen Apocalypse so far - but to be fair, we haven't see that much. The image above seems to be a cropped version of the previous pic of the villain with Storm and Psylocke, but it still offers a much more detailed look at the design of the character. As for why Singer and co. went with that particular visage, actor Oscar Isaac explains.

“We had to do some adjustments here and there and be like, alright, maybe this is too alien,” the actor tells EW. “He also is someone who people would want to follow and not just be terrified of. So the balance, and then making sure that there’s some great elements from the comic but also making our own thing as well. In the comic, he generally is like 12 feet, 600 pounds.” Some fans would have been perfectly happy with that! But does this close-up of Apocalypse come across any better at all?

Isaac had one more intriguing tease about the final battle of the film, in which En Sabah Nur will apparently take on a LOT of other mutants. “I mean that last battle is going to be pretty insane. I mean, it’s like freaking Apocalypse fighting all of the X-Men. It’s pretty cool.”
